Output d693465bcb73385ff420a9d1b8b81593b2d037749137fa7e2f23b52e03441a99:5

value
4028703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81afe3295b89234a62cf879aec88e6a5aaf34b74 OP_EQUAL
address
3DWjoA53C2V53Nufz4rP61drasyBq7zqfj
transaction
d693465bcb73385ff420a9d1b8b81593b2d037749137fa7e2f23b52e03441a99
spent
true